Sailing in Cantabria

Cantabria has 15 boat rental companies and 12 of them are on the Bay of Santander, the largest sheltered bay on the Cantabrian coast: Marina de Cudeyo (Pedreña), with 6 and the biggest marina; Camargo (Maliaño), with 3 and the top-rated company in the region; Santander city, with 2; and El Astillero. Outside the bay, Laredo has 2 in its marina, with the Bay of Santoña as its playground, and Noja one. Castro Urdiales, Comillas and San Vicente de la Barquera have harbours but no registered rental companies. Two companies advertise skippered hire and one sailing boats; no-licence boats are rare on the Cantabrian coast.

The season runs from June to September. Inside the bays of Santander and Santoña you sail in almost any sea; outside, swell and a tide of more than four metres. Santander is one of the northern cities with the most demand for boat trips.

Indicative prices

Indicative high-season prices from the directory's reference table, reviewed September 2026: a no-licence motorboat costs €120–250 a day; a RIB of 6–8 m, €250–650; a 10–12 m sailing yacht, €400–900 bareboat or €600–1,500 skippered; a catamaran, €1,000–2,500; a skippered motor yacht, from €900. Expect 20–40% less outside July and August. Deposits run from €300 to €2,000 and fuel is extra. Each company sets its own prices.

Frequently asked questions

Where can I hire a boat in Cantabria?

On the Bay of Santander: Pedreña (6 companies), Maliaño (3), Santander (2) and El Astillero. Laredo has 2 and Noja one; the other harbours have no registered companies.

Do I need a licence to hire a boat in Cantabria?

For motorboats and sailing boats, an ICC or Spanish licence, or a skipper (two companies). Motorboats up to 5 metres and 15 hp can be driven without a licence in daylight inside the bay; ask which company has them.

How much does it cost to hire a boat in Cantabria?

Indicatively, €250–650 a day for a RIB with licence and €400–1,500 for a sailing boat depending on skipper. Fuel and deposit are extra.

What should I know about the tide in Cantabria?

That it rises and falls more than four metres and uncovers banks in the bays of Santander and Santoña. You sail the buoyed channels with the tide table.

Are there boat trips in Cantabria?

Yes, and in high demand: round the Bay of Santander from Los Reginas, round the Bay of Santoña and along the coast from Castro and San Vicente. They are listed under the boat trips category.
